A dozen students from Pella Christian High School and one from Pella Community High School competed in the National History Day event earlier this week in Des Moines. Though none of the students from Pella schools were chosen to advance on to the national competition, Pella Christian junior Abigail Fincel was selected as one of four finalists in her category. Fincel’s project was on gyroscopes, and was titled “Gyroscopes: Navigating through History, and Guiding into the Future”.

Teacher Librarian Sheri Haveman, who advised the students from Pella Christian, said her students enjoyed the experience and and said it was good to see how tough the state level of the competition was. She adds that her students enjoyed seeing what other students around the state were working on and how much time they put in.

This year’s National History Day theme was “Innovation in History: Impact and Change,” and was chosen by a national panel.
